QuestionGeneral requirement for Civil Engineering Works in 1992 Edition, Clause 15.09 details that tying wires for strengthening adjacent to and above Class F4 and F5 closes must be stainless steel wires. Give genuine reasons? AnswerIf plain steel tying wires are utilize for reinforcement adjacent to Class F4 and F5 closes, it poses problem of rust staining that may impair appearance of uncovered concrete surfaces. Speed of corrosion of plain steel tying wires is alike to regular steel reinforcement. Yet, for tying wires with extremely tiny diameter, upon long exposure it stands a high possibility of rusting finally and this rust will stain formwork and significantly involve concrete finish. Then, stainless steel tying wires are specified for locations in vicinity of high excellence of finishes to keep away from rust staining by corroded typing wires.
